Output 13d6efe928e57d8934ee0214bbfe3b7ccadf89aaac988cb944d1b55795404375:656

value
771
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5afb78c1f8537f1c3b63499039ef8a8e4c26e2acb6904965c799731277da233f
address
bc1pttah3s0c2dl3cwmrfxgrnmu23exzdc4vk6gyjew8n9e3ya76yvlsltfhgf
transaction
13d6efe928e57d8934ee0214bbfe3b7ccadf89aaac988cb944d1b55795404375
confirmations
103422
spent
true